Another issue with the TODO file. >@subsection thelistjtaginterfaces JTAG Interfaces > >The following tasks have been suggeted for improving OpenOCD's JTAG >interface support: > >- rework USB communication to be more robust. Two possible options are: > -# use libusb-1.0.1 with libusb-compat-0.1.1 (non-blocking I/O wrapper) > -# rewrite implementation to use non-blocking I/O
I agree with the 2nd part (to use non-blocking I/O). I believe the first one is wrong. If you use libusb-compat-0.1, it would not help too much as it is still using the synchronous API of libusb-0.1. There may be some slight speed difference but you would not gain too much. Instead, the above should have been. - rework USB communication to be more robust. One possible option is: -# use libusb-1.0 and asynchronous I/O.
